The Bacon Brothers have got a lot of heart. In fact, it all pours out on New Year’s Day, the duo’s latest collection of inspired, cinematic folk rock. Iconic actor Kevin Bacon (Mystic River, Wild Things, The Woodsman, Footloose) and his brother Michael know how to write a good tune, and that’s instantly apparent after one spin of their latest offering.

For Kevin, songwriting starts at home. “We grew up in Philly and there are some songs on the record that are very evocative of Philly soul music,” says Kevin with a smile. “We have a lot of different influences, and the guys in the band influence us as well. We like to keep our ears open and take in as much music as possible.”

That approach has served the Brothers well, especially on the album’s standout track, “Kikko’s Song.” Dissecting that particular cut, Kevin continues, “My wife’s nickname is ‘Kikko.’ I sort of wrote the song for both of us. There was a philosophy she was starting to embrace. Remembering some of the sentiments of the song, it’s funny because it speaks as much to myself as much as it does to her. That’s part of what helping people through rough times and marriage are about. It’s got some of those same thoughts that we’ve expressed to each other at different times.”
